The Supreme Court affirmed the judgment of the Court of Common Pleas on the 9th of June, 1884, in the following opinion,

Per Curiam :

The rule which applies to an apparant alteration of commercial paper, does not apply with equal strictness to an instrument under seal. In view of the fact that this note was under seal, the case was properly submitted to the jury and on evidence.

Judgment affirmed.
